SHRM-CP WORKPLACE Questions - Part 1

1. Which best characterizes today's global organization?

A) Any organization with operations in both developed and emerging economies and established cultural diversity to achieve success
B) Any large multinational corporation with global subsidiaries, vast resources, and a network of mobile global subject matter experts
C) Any organization, large or small, whose processes, actions, and decisions are firmly rooted in a carefully conceived global strategy
D) Any organization that is grossing more than $1 million and doing business in more than two countries and that has a diversity of thought



2. Which is critical for HR to understand when considering forces for globalization?

A) Determining whether a force is political, technological, economic, or social
B) Identifying whether a force will have a positive or negative impact
C) Learning whether a force's origin is an emerging or a developed economy
D) Understanding which forces are significant to the organization and to HR responsibilities



3. Which critical role does HR need to assume in light of globalization?

A) Overseeing workforce management policy shifts due to increased offshoring
B) Balancing an organization's global strategy with policy localization to reflect national cultures and laws
C) Ensuring that an organization's global strategy isn't influenced by its workforce's local cultures
D) Ensuring that local management isn't prejudiced by global policies



4. How does hyperconnectivity assist an organization in achieving its strategic goals?

A) Through the digital interconnection of people and things, any time and any place
B) Through the economic interconnection between emerging and developed economies
C) Through the interconnection of all PESTLE forces: political, economic, social, technological, legal, and environmental
D) Through the significant increase in the speed of broadband connections



5. Which characterizes globalization?

A) Global markets, economies, and technologies are increasingly interconnected.
B) Technology has become globalization's single shaping force.
C) Developed economies play an increasingly dominant role in globalization.
D) Global interconnections reached a peak in the 1980s and 1990s and have since decreased.



1. Right Answer: C
Explanation: Because of technologies and the growing ease of doing business across borders, a global organization is no longer defined by its size or physical presence in multiple countries but by its global strategy.

2. Right Answer: D
Explanation: An HR professional's goal in considering any aspect of globalization is to strive to understand which globalization events, forces, and trends are significant for a given organization and for HR responsibilities in that organization. Whatever the force's type or origin, its impact will be unique for that organization.

3. Right Answer: B
Explanation: Globalization has made the role of HR more critical and more complex. In developing and implementing global strategies, global HR must constantly balance standardization of policies influenced by the organization's values and global strategy with the need to localize these policies through programs and practices that reflect organizational and national cultures and local laws.

4. Right Answer: A
Explanation: The World Economic Forum defines hyperconnectivity as the 'increasing digital interconnection of peopleβ€”and thingsβ€”anytime and anyplace.' It is the purely digital/virtual aspect of globalization's 'accelerating interconnectedness.'

5. Right Answer: A
Explanation: The integration of markets, nation-states, and technologies is enabling individuals, corporations, and nation-states to reach around the world farther, faster, deeper, and cheaper than ever before.
